India visa requirements for citizens of United States.

eVisaStays of up to 30 days per visit.We can submit this for you

Yes — citizens of the United States typically need an eVisa for India, applied for online before travel; stays of up to 30 days are typically allowed.

e-Visa; designated airports/seaports only
